The Opportunity:

British Transport Police have an opportunity for a Media Relations Advisor to join the External Affairs and Media department. As a Media Relations Advisor with BTP, you are the voice of BTP and play a vital role in supporting the Force to prevent and detect crime, as well as building and protecting public confidence - by responding to and proactively engaging with both the media and the public through BTP-owned social media channels.

A key part of the criminal justice process, they produce statements, crime appeals, convictions and sentences for BTP cases. They are expected to find new and innovative ways to engage with the communities we serve - be that responding to a comment on Twitter, joining the latest TikTok trend or reaching people through a local Facebook page.

Media Relations Advisors also participate in the 24/7 on-call rota, responding to journalists and incidents outside of office hours. They need the confidence to react to breaking news, the gravitas to give sound advice to senior officers and the ability to handle both traditional and social media during high profile incidents and cases.


What you'll be doing:

  • Act as one of the key voices of British Transport Police, responding to media enquiries, handling breaking news and providing clear, accurate information during critical incidents and court‑related communications.
  • Write, shape and release compelling content, including crime appeals, convictions and sentencing updates, adapting messages for different audiences and platforms to build confidence and support policing outcomes.
  • Provide trusted advice and guidance to senior leaders, investigators and internal teams, ensuring all communications align with media law, operational needs and reputational considerations.
  • Proactively monitor media and social trends, identifying risks and opportunities, escalating issues where required, and supporting strategic planning across BTP’s national portfolios.


What you'll bring to the team:

  • Experience working in a busy press office, newsroom or fast‑paced communications environment, with a proven ability to write accurately and quickly for different audiences.
  • Strong judgement and decision‑making skills, with the confidence to independently manage breaking incidents, out‑of‑hours enquiries and complex media issues.
  • Excellent communication, influencing and relationship‑building skills, able to work with, and effectively communicate to, journalists, investigators, senior leaders and partners.
  • A solid understanding of media law (or willingness to develop this quickly), including court reporting restrictions, anonymity rules and reputational risk.
  • Exceptional organisational skills, able to prioritise competing demands, react at pace, and deliver clear, coherent communication plans.
